WebThere are four major types (or “ranks”) of coal. Rank refers to steps in a slow, natural process called “coalification,” during which buried plant matter changes into an ever denser, drier, more carbon-rich, and harder … WebCoalification is a geological process of formation of materials with increasing content of the element carbon from organic materials that occurs in a first, biological stage into peats, followed by a gradual transformation into coal by action of moderate temperature (about 500 K) and high pressure in a geochemical stage. The conversion of graphite to diamonds takes some more millions of years. citilink fort wayne indianaWebThe process that converts peat to coal is called coalification. The degree of coalification which has taken place determines the rank of the coal.
